- ${record[FM['comments']]}
+ ${Markup(extra)}${record[FM['comments']]}
'''))
@@ -243,11 +244,23 @@ class LibraryServer(object):
books = []
for record in iter(self.db):
if 'EPUB' in record[FIELD_MAP['formats']].upper():
- authors = ' & '.join([i.replace('|', ',') for i in record[2].split(',')])
+ authors = ' & '.join([i.replace('|', ',') for i in record[FIELD_MAP['authors']].split(',')])
+ extra = []
+ rating = record[FIELD_MAP['rating']]
+ if rating > 0:
+ rating = ''.join(repeat('★', rating))
+ extra.append('RATING: %s